Leclerc doesn't surrender easily: he braked later than Perez despite his braking system issue!🔥
Despite not having a tow, Perez's top speed was 3km/h higher, which was crucial to conclude the overtake.
The double slipstream made Sainz reach 303km/h while Russell was 'cruising'.
Perez was alongside Leclerc since very early on the straight, so his top speed was not impacted by a tow.

🗒Notes on #Saudi Arabian GP!
-Traction and braking (Ferrari’s strength… when they work properly!) matter much less than in Bahrain
-Low asphalt abrasion➡️Strong track evolution
-Many fast left-handers➡️High wear of the right tyres
-Low drag: crucial

Rear wings - Saudi Arabian GP
(RB as reference)
-🟢Merc: shallow lower plane and lower angle of attack of the upper plane➡️Least drag and downforce
-🟠McL and particularly🔵RB generate most of their downforce through the upper plane➡️More effective DRS
-🔴Ferrari: opposite to RB

BEST SECTORS - FP2📊
Alonso was quickest in both the slowest sector (S1, many medium-speed corners) AND in the fastest one (S33: two straights connected by a hairpin)➡️Considering his relatively loaded rear wing he was higher on power than most drivers, but possibly on less fuel too.
Merc had a 9km/h top speed advantage over McL: completely different wing levels (Compare the 3rd sector!) But which one will be the right choice?🤔

Through his pole, Verstappen BARELY takes Hamilton's record for the fastest lap ever around Jeddah!💡 254.1 km/h AVERAGE speed (vs 254.0) Laptime evolution: 2021 1:27.511 (Old-gen) 2022 1:28.200 (Ground effect era) 2023 1:28.265 (Raised floors) 2024 1:27.472
Additionally, in 2023 a few corners were tweaked to make the track slightly slower, which explains the 2023 times being slightly slower than in 2022.
So the record is even more impressive: the ground-effect cars get closer to the best all-time performance the faster a track is.
